From f1cbd033e201a18c7175bc6509b48d6243e79739 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jeff King Date: Thu, 5 Sep 2019 18:52:25 -0400 Subject: pack-objects: use object_id in packlist_alloc() The only caller of packlist_alloc() already has a "struct object_id", and we immediately copy the hash they pass us into our own object_id. Let's avoid the unnecessary round-trip to a raw sha1 pointer.
